Output 6ac6ca415bf476557d1d7cd05abdd8fe592f5e456edeaffca8ea2ad79fee4ecb:0

value
313002368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e7b27d5c1a9cf4d34236293e893606b81f4e81 OP_EQUAL
address
3EAuPEmLdpfRGm5JWb2LpkTZv2mPGXuECf
transaction
6ac6ca415bf476557d1d7cd05abdd8fe592f5e456edeaffca8ea2ad79fee4ecb
confirmations
318907
spent
true